Transaction c143c360933c878a255982be5a6a1b92bf0b5fffb29f8f012f5420b86a81eae1

block
08f98c50fdf6c7ddd8358153e4a65ba6ee1e1891770f6a161ef2641ed9cc7ec8

60 Inputs

6 Outputs